Android [Free][Game]MTB Downhill: Canyon

Discussion in 'Android Games' started by plasticcow, Mar 25, 2022.

  1. plasticcow

    plasticcow Active Member

    #1 plasticcow, Mar 25, 2022
    Last edited: Mar 25, 2022
    Looking for a super fast 3D mountain bike game? You've just found it!

    MTB Downhill: Canyon will have you hurtling downhill at breakneck speeds on your mountain bike through the stunning canyons trying to improve on best times and avoiding spectacular ragdoll crashes.
    No coins to collect, no IAPs to bleed you dry, just speed!

    Google Play Store


    [​IMG]
     

Share This Page